We are looking for a dynamic, detail-oriented Chartered Accountant (CA) to join our finance team. This position is open to both freshers with an exceptional academic record and experienced professionals with a background in the hotel industry. The ideal candidate will have strong financial expertise and a keen ability to adapt quickly to new challenges. As a CA, the candidate will be responsible for managing and overseeing various finance-related functions. Key Responsibilities:Financial Reporting: Prepare and review financial statements, ensuring compliance with accounting standards, statutory regulations, and company policies.Taxation: Oversee tax-related tasks, including income tax, GST filings, and tax audits, while ensuring timely and accurate filing.Audit: Assist with internal and external audits to ensure financial transparency and compliance.Financial Planning & Analysis: Work on budgeting, forecasting, and variance analysis to guide business decisions.Compliance & Risk Management: Ensure that all financial and accounting processes comply with the regulatory environment. Identify financial risks and suggest strategies to mitigate them.Coordination: Collaborate with the finance team to transfer finance-related tasks from Pawandeep and ensure smooth transition and continuity.Cash Flow & Liquidity Management: Oversee and manage working capital, ensuring the company maintains optimal cash flow.Team Support: Work closely with senior management to provide finance and accounting insights for strategic decisions.Skills & Qualifications: Educational Qualification: Chartered Accountant (CA) with 1st attempt pass and excellent academic background. Graduation with more than 80% marks is highly preferred.Experience:Freshers with exceptional academic background and strong analytical skills.2 to 3 years of experience in finance, particularly in the hotel industry, will be a plus.Technical Skills:Proficiency in accounting software (e.g., Tally, SAP, QuickBooks).Advanced Excel skills, including data analysis and financial modeling.Knowledge: Strong understanding of accounting principles, tax laws, and financial regulations.Personal Traits:Smart, proactive, and a quick learner.Str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and the ability to work under pressure.Communication Skills: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to liaise with senior stakeholders.
